Effectively managing suppliers is critical to the success of procurement organizations. But as supply chains become more geographically extended and the numbers of suppliers steadily increases, organizations need to take proactive measures in order to mitigate any disruptions that could potentially arise within their supply chain which can be very costly in terms of financial performance and the company’s reputation. By implementing a supplier management solution, organizations are able to take a strategic approach and effectively manage their suppliers. Below are some of the reasons your company should focus on implementing a modern, supplier management solution:

1. Increase Visibility and Minimize Supplier Risk

According to the recent Deloitte Global Chief Procurement Officer survey, 61% of procurement leaders reported that they have seen an increase in risks within the last year and only 37% of procurement organizations are prepared to address those risks. What is even more alarming is that in that same report, 65% of CPOs said that they had limited or no visibility beyond their Tier 1 suppliers. While supplier risks can never be completely mitigated, the first step that an organization can take to help mitigate supplier risks and minimize losses is investing in a supplier management solution so they have a systematic way of qualifying suppliers and increasing the visibility into their supply base.

Implementing a platform, such as Oracle Supplier Qualification Management Cloud, allows procurement organizations to effectively manage their supplier qualifications and capabilities and mitigate any potential risks. Using a built-in survey mechanism that is entirely configurable to your organizations specifications, users are able to collect necessary information from internal and external stakeholders that is vital to their business, such as critical capabilities and certifications. This allows organizations to easily detect any potential risks and monitor the compliance of their suppliers.

2. Ensure Accurate Supplier Data

Supplier information is constantly changing and having stale supplier information can potentially cause delays and add additional risks. In the Spend Matters’ article, The Future of Procurement: Accurate Vendor Master Data, they shared that, “94% of financial and procurement executives don’t completely trust their supplier master data.”  With an automated supplier management solution, organizations can ensure that they have consistent and standardized supplier profile data that is accurate and up-to-date and can organize their suppliers in to categories.

Using Oracle Supplier Qualification Management Cloud, all of the collected information becomes part of your supplier’s profile, ensuring that your organization has the most up-to-date information for managing your suppliers. Also, users are automatically alerted when a qualification is about to expire or when new information about their supplier becomes available that may potentially impact their qualifications and profile, ensuring that they take the necessary steps for renewals and qualifications.

3. Strengthen Supplier Relationship

Good and reliable suppliers are hard to come by. And when an organization has several suppliers that they partner with, it’s difficult to have the same high-level relationship with each one. By implementing a supplier management solution, organizations can ensure their procurement processes are running more smoothly and can break down communications barriers, improve supplier collaboration which in return can increase supplier loyalty.

Oracle Supplier Portal provides organizations with a supplier work area that allows users to have complete visibility into transactions, improve supplier communication and enable electronic invoicing. Users are able to access agreements, purchase orders, advance shipment notifications, invoices and negotiations enabling suppliers to address specific needs for an organization.

4. Quickly Onboard Suppliers

The time and resources needed to onboard a new supplier can be time consuming and can decrease the productivity of your team. Using Oracle Supplier Portal Cloud, procurement organizations are able to streamline their supplier on-boarding through a self-registration process. Suppliers are provided with all the tools they need to manage and maintain their supplier information such as addresses, contacts, payment information as well as business classifications for compliance and reporting.
